Looking for a way to increase student engagement during the spring months? This mixed ELA skills Save the Garden spring escape room challenge is perfect any time during the spring! It makes an excellent language arts review or test prep review as well!
Throughout the activity, students work collaboratively with partners or in groups to solve language arts related challenges and find clues in order to save the garden while there's still time!
This escape room is perfect for in-person, hybrid, or virtual learning as it includes both a printable PDF AND digital version!

ELA SKILLS (Explicitly Covered, But Not Limited to):
- Reading Comprehension
- Text Evidence
- Point of View & Perspective
- Vocabulary & Context Clues
- Nonfiction Text Features
- Run-Ons, Fragments, & Complete Sentences
- Main Idea & Supporting Details
